Hi Sir,I have been using code for printing the part of web page.Its working fine on local system but showing error on serverI used following code for this.
Compilation Error
Description: An error occurred during the compilation of a resource required to service this request. Please review the following specific error details and modify your source code appropriately.
Compiler Error Message: CS0103: The name 'PrintHelper' does not exist in the current context
Source Error:
Line 13: string value=
Line 14: Request.Form["ctrl"];
Line 15: PrintHelper.PrintWebControl(value);
Line 16: }
Line 17: }
Print.aspx.cs
using System;using System.Collections.Generic;using System.Linq;using System.Web;using System.Web.UI;using System.Web.UI.WebControls;using System.Runtime.Remoting;
public partial class User_Print : System.Web.UI.Page{ protected void Page_Load(object sender, EventArgs e) { Control ctrl = (Control)Session["ctrl"]; PrintHelper.PrintWebControl(ctrl); }}
Used PrintHelper.cs file under App_Code
using System;using System.Data;using System.Configuration;using System.Web;using System.Web.Security;using System.Web.UI;using System.Web.UI.WebControls;using System.Web.UI.WebControls.WebParts; using System.Web.UI.HtmlControls;using System.IO;using System.Text;using System.Web.SessionState;using System.Runtime.Remoting;
public class PrintHelper{ public PrintHelper() { }
public static void PrintWebControl(Control ctrl) { PrintWebControl(ctrl, string.Empty); }
public static void PrintWebControl(Control ctrl, string Script) { StringWriter stringWrite = new StringWriter(); System.Web.UI.HtmlTextWriter htmlWrite = new System.Web.UI.HtmlTextWriter(stringWrite); if (ctrl is WebControl) { Unit w = new Unit(100, UnitType.Percentage); ((WebControl)ctrl).Width = w; } Page pg = new Page(); pg.EnableEventValidation = false; if (Script != string.Empty) { pg.ClientScript.RegisterStartupScript(pg.GetType(), "PrintJavaScript", Script); } HtmlForm frm = new HtmlForm(); pg.Controls.Add(frm); frm.Attributes.Add("runat", "server"); frm.Controls.Add(ctrl); pg.DesignerInitialize(); pg.RenderControl(htmlWrite); string strHTML = stringWrite.ToString(); HttpContext.Current.Response.Clear(); HttpContext.Current.Response.Write(strHTML); HttpContext.Current.Response.Write(""); HttpContext.Current.Response.End(); }}
